Photos of Greek Village Grill

Alpine, US

11 photos
10 dishes
1 interior
Greek Village Grill
Greek Village Grill
Greek Village Grill
Greek Village Grill
Greek Village Grill
Greek Village Grill
Greek Village Grill
Greek Village Grill
Greek Village Grill
Greek Village Grill
Content will be available in 8 seconds...
Advertisement